在将数据加载到ElasticSearch时,ElasticSearch Hadoop中的Jackson出错

时间:2015-04-17 12:56:14

标签: jackson hive apache-pig elasticsearch-hadoop

我正在尝试使用HDFS版本ElasticSearch将数据从elasticsearch-hadoop加载到elasticsearch-hadoop-2.1.0.Beta3.jar

Mapr上有一个错误: https://github.com/elastic/elasticsearch-hadoop/issues/215 应该修复jackson问题。但它仍然从Hadoop目录中获取jacksonjackson版本1.5。{/ p>

我已添加REGISTER个命令来注册1.8个罐子:

REGISTER /opt/mapr/hive/hive/lib/jackson-core-asl-1.8.8.jar;
REGISTER /opt/mapr/hive/hive/lib/jackson-jaxrs-1.8.8.jar;
REGISTER /opt/mapr/hive/hive/lib/jackson-mapper-asl-1.8.8.jar;
REGISTER /opt/mapr/hive/hive/lib/jackson-xc-1.8.8.jar;

但我仍然收到以下错误:

2015-04-17 05:49:03,760 [main] ERROR org.apache.pig.tools.pigstats.SimplePigStats - ERROR 2997: Unable to recreate exception from backed error: 
Error: org.codehaus.jackson.map.ObjectMapper.reader(Ljava/lang/Class;)Lorg/codehaus/jackson/map/ObjectReader;

我和Hive一样尝试过同样的错误。

0 个答案:

没有答案